Want to command an AC-130 gunship? Of course you do.
The Official Xbox 360 magazine (UK) had some fresh info on the co-op Spec Ops mode, which is getting a lot of attention at the moment.
When I watched it being played at Gamescom, Infinity Ward weren't too forthcoming about how many levels Spec Ops mode would have. According to the magazine, there will be 5 missions open to start with, each with 3 difficulty levels. Completing the different difficulties will award you between 1 and 3 stars and by collecting stars you will unlock new groups of levels. The first 5 are the Alpha levels and you work your way through Bravo all the way to Echo. Both players will need to have unlocked each level if they want to buddy up.
There were a few other tantalising snippets from their feature. There is the exciting prospect of some missions requiring you hold out against waves of enemies using claymores and sniper rifles (horde mode?). When I previewed the game, I pondered how cool it would be if co-op featured the AC-130. OXM confirmed that you would indeed get to sit in the gunship. You support your co-op partner as they desperately try not to get annihilated by your helpful firestorm.
